ALEXANDRIA, Va., Dec. 16 -- United States Patent no. 12,499,257, issued on Dec. 16, was assigned to Tetrate.io (San Francisco).

"Repeatable NGAC policy class structure" was invented by Zack Daniel Butcher (San Francisco), Ignacio Barrera Caparros (Barcelona, Spain) and Joshua Douglas Roberts (Ashburn, Va.).
